visual basic 6 da güncelleme olayı için temel olarak 3 şey gereklidir.
1.web sitesi
2.html dosyamız
3.programımız
öncelikle kendimize versiyonu kontrol edeceğimiz bir kontrol dosyası oluşturalım ve bu kontrol.html olsun
ve bunun içine
<input type="text" id="version" value="1"> yazıyoruz. burdaki id ye versiyon dememiz programla bunu kontrol etmemiz için eşsiz bi isim yaratır.
ve biz bu isim üzerinden kontrol yapabiliriz.buraya ahmet yada mehmette yazabilirsiniz.
daha sonra bunu web sitemize atıyoruz. ben
http://yazilimadair.com/diger/programlama/vb6/kontrol.html adresine attım bunu
daha sonra visual basic 6 programımızı acıp yeni bir proje acıyoruz

ve sağ tarafa sag tıklayarak components e tıklıyoruz
Resmi büyük boyutta görmek için tıklayınız.

listeden microsoft internet controls ü seçerek tamam diyoruz. daha sonra soldaki listemize geliyor bu component
Resmi büyük boyutta görmek için tıklayınız.

daha sonra bu componentimizi programımıza ekliyoruz ve formumuzun load olayına
WebBrowser1.Navigate ("http://yazilimadair.com/diger/programlama/vb6/kontrol.html")
siz kendi dosyanızın adresini yazıcaksınız ben kendiminkini yazdım sonra formunuza bir adet label ekleyin ve buraya 0 yazın ve daha sonra webbrowser objemizin ******** complete olayına
If WebBrowser1.********.GetElementById("version").Value > Label1.Caption Then
MsgBox "yeni versiyon var"
End If
yazıyoruz label1 bizim program versiyonumuz oluyor kontrol.html ise mevcut versiyonumuz oluyor.
eğer programın versiyonu kontrol.html den düşük oluyorsa doğal olarak yeni versiyon cıkmıs oluyor.
eğer label1′i 1 yaparsanız yeni versiyon var demiyecektir.bu şekilde versiyon kontrol ettirip indirme linkini program ile açtırabilirsiniz.